European atmosphere will pervade the whole Boston Garden from ten o'clock to midnight today and tomorrow at a Carnival for Freedom for the benefit of various British, French, Dutch, Finnish, and Polish relief societies.
Mrs. Bruce C. Hopper, wife of the Government professor, is helping in the program which will feature foreign foods, dancing and all kinds of booths and games. Men in uniform may enter for 50 cents; all others one dollar apiece.
